D.I.T.C.

The Diggin' in the Crates Crew, also known as D.I.T.C., is a New York-based hip-hop collective, deriving its name from the art of seeking out records to sample for production. Its members have achieved substantial and consistent recognition in underground rap circles, often collaborating with undiscovered talent and underground artists (Madlib produces the first track on A.G.'s new album) alongside the most commercial of rappers (Puff Daddy, Nelly and Lil Wayne have been featured on Fat Joe's albums and Buckwild has produced for Biggie Smalls, Jay-Z and 50 Cent). All of its members are from the Bronx, with the exception of Big L (from Harlem) and O.C. (from Brooklyn).
